What's Happening?
The Buffalo Bills are gearing up for the 2026 NFL season with significant changes to their pass rush lineup. After a lackluster performance last year, the team has made strategic acquisitions to bolster their defense. Notably, the Bills signed Bradley
Chubb to a three-year, $43.5 million deal and drafted T.J. Parker in the second round. These moves aim to enhance the team's ability to pressure opposing quarterbacks, a critical area where they struggled previously. Greg Rousseau, who led the team in sacks last season, remains a pivotal player, while Michael Hoecht, returning from an injury, and rookie Parker are expected to compete for key roles. The team also added Mike Danna to compete for a spot on the roster, highlighting the competitive nature of the upcoming training camp.
